Technical recruiter Fircroft has entered into a joint venture agreement with Kazakh industrial group Centrasia. 

In a statement, Fircroft chief executive Johnathan Johnson said Centrasia would become a “turnkey solutions partner for major energy clients in the country”.

The UK recently signed £3bn in business deals with the former Soviet state, including agreements to support four new gas plants and a steel production facility in Kazakhstan.

Fircroft’s deal was signed during the second meeting of the UK-Kazakhstan Inter-Governmental Commission on Trade-Economic, Scientific-Technical and Cultural Co-Operation in early November.
